Looks fine overall, but note for maintainers: the offline sync logic in TrailNote buffers survey entries locally and flushes in batches once connectivity returns. Batch size and retry backoff interact badly if you change one without the other — see the Kellwick incident notes. The current values are set out below.

tuning constants:
BUDGETS = {
    "druath": 240,
    "lamwyn": 180,
    "silael": 275,
}

# Dedup pipeline settings — notes for the weekly sync
# The MergeWell dedup job now runs nightly against the customer_records table.
# Matching is fuzzy on name + postal prefix; confidence below 0.85 goes to the
# review queue instead of auto-merging. Last week's run merged ~2,300 pairs with
# zero rollbacks. Tune thresholds under [matcher] only, not [writer].
# The job reads and writes through the connection configured below.

replica DSN, kajep-yahag: mssql://praok_svc:iF@db-8d68.plorvaio.local:5432/eliion

TURN-208: Gatevale turnstile counters at the Merrow Field pilot double-count when a rotation reverses mid-cycle. Attendance totals drift roughly 2% high per event. The debounce window fix is implemented, reviewed by Ilsa, and soak-tested across two simulated match days without drift. Ready for your cut; the candidate build is identified below.

trace token, tagag-tafog: htk6_5ed18c

Changed defaults in Splitfork, our assignment service. Bucketing now uses sticky hashing per account instead of per session, and the holdout slice grew from 2% to 5%. Callers relying on session-level reassignment must opt in explicitly. Review the diff against the new baseline; the updated default configuration is listed below.

config for tagep-kajof:
[casir]
port = 6379
region = south-1
host = casir.paliqdyn.example
team = tamax
timeout_ms = 250
retries = 2